I have read the information previous supplied and found some useful
tidbits/information.
This is to better explain what I am trying to accomplish
server alarm.home.org <-- fetchmail <-- 1@xxxxxxxxxxx
Dovecot/SMTP <-- 2@xxxxxxxxxxx
<-- 3@xxxxxxxxxxx
<-- 4@xxxxxxxxxxx
The fetchmail delivers all emails to
oldfart@xxxxxxxxx (dovecot on alarm.home.arpa)
(smtp on alarm.home.arpa)
^
|
|
Thunderbird then reads the account oldfart@xxxxxxxxx (IMAP)
Reply to 3@xxxxxxxxxxx --> www.twc.com smarthost
Reply to 1@xxxxxxxxxxx --> www.twc.com smarthost
New message to arch-general@xxxxxxxxxxxxxxxxxxx from pocket@xxxxxxxxxx
So SMTP needs to rewrite oldfart@xxxxxxxxx to 3@xxxxxxxxxxx
use 3@xxxxxxxxxxx credentials to www.twc.com
rewrite oldfart@xxxxxxxxx to 1@xxxxxxxxxxx
use 1@xxxxxxxxxxx credentials to www.twc.com
rewrite oldfart@xxxxxxxxx to pocket@xxxxxxxxxxx
use pocket@xxxxxxxxxxx credentials to www.twc.com
Dovecot to use PAM to validate user oldfart, Maildir on /srv/Mail/<user>
SMTP to use dovecot credentials
STARTTLS/TLS connection required to www.twc.com
No TLS/SSL required on the local network, but if it is required to do so
then so be it.
Procedure:
Step 1. create certs
Step 2. install/configure dovecot
Step 3. install/configure a SMTP daemon
I hope this makes this more clear of what I am trying to accomplish.
All help welcomne
Thanks for your help
--
Hindi madali ang maging ako